Subject: LogSkimmer release handover

Hi — handing over LogSkimmer (our internal log-tailing CLI) releases to you while I'm out. Everything's scripted: `make release` builds, signs, and pushes to the internal mirror. For your security review, the signing setup is the main thing worth auditing — single key, rotated quarterly, last rotation two weeks ago. The currently active signing key is:

release key, fajef-kajeg: bky19_LdLu6Ne6FLi8he2c24d

Handover Note — Factory Capacity Decision

To branch managers, from outgoing director Marek Oduvane to incoming director Petra Lindqvist: the Harrowfen plant will not add a third shift this year. Demand for the Crestware line justifies expansion, but tooling lead times make it impractical before spring. Overflow routes to the Tessmore site under the existing arrangement. Petra will confirm final volumes after the supplier review. Context for that decision appears in the confidential note below.

internal memo for yahag-tahog: The pricing group signed off on a budget of $152.8 million for Project Soriel.

## Changelog — Sheetforge export defaults

Export memory usage is down roughly 60%. Sheetforge now streams rows instead of buffering full workbooks, so large exports no longer fail around 200k rows. Default row cap raised from 250k to 1M; cell-style caching is off by default. Customers may notice exports start faster but download slightly slower. If a customer reports truncated files, check their plan tier first. Current defaults are listed below.

settings of tagef-bawif:
DRUIX_HOST=druix.zemvarlabs.internal
DRUIX_PORT=8000